Ma Long can call himself the undisputed best player in the world after he won the World Table Tennis Championships.

World number one Ma Long finally ended his wait for glory in the World Table Tennis Championships with victory in the 2015 men's singles final against Fang Bo.

Three times a bronze medallist, Ma emerged victorious from an all-Chinese final in Suzhou, triumphing 11-7 7-11 11-4 11-8 11-13 11-4 over the number 13 seed.

Fang did his best to keep himself in a contest marked by a number of superb rallies, but eventually succumbed to Ma's superior quality.

At 10-3 in the sixth game, the 26-year-old held seven championship points and Fang could only save one as his quest to win the St Bride Vase came to an unsuccessful end, with Ma cementing his status as the best player on the planet.
